Turnstile (symbol)

From Wikipedia, the free encyclopedia
Jump to: navigation, search

In mathematical logic and computer science the symbol \vdash has taken the name turnstile because of its resemblance to a typical turnstile if viewed from above. It is also referred to as tee and is often read as "yields", "proves", "satisfies" or "entails". The symbol was first used by Gottlob Frege in his 1879 book on logic, Begriffsschrift[1].

In TeX, the turnstile symbol \vdash is obtained from the command \vdash. In Unicode, the turnstile symbol is called right tack and is at code point U+22A2[2]. On a typewriter, a turnstile can be composed from a vertical bar (|) and a dash (-). In LaTeX there is the turnstile package, which issues this sign in many ways, and is capable of putting labels below or above it, in the correct places. The article A Tool for Logicians is a tutorial on using this package.

[edit] Meaning

The turnstile is a binary relation. It has several different meanings in different contexts:

[edit] See also

[edit] Notes

  1. ^ Gottlob Frege, Begriffsschrift: Eine der arithmetischen nachgebildete Formelsprache des reinen Denkens. Halle, 1879.
  2. ^ Unicode standard
  3. ^ A. S. Troelstra and H. Schwichtenberg, Basic Proof Theory, second edition, Cambridge University Press, 2000, ISBN 978-0-521-77911-1.
  4. ^ http://www.mscs.dal.ca/~selinger/papers/lambdanotes.pdf
  5. ^ David A. Schmidt, The Structure of Typed Programming Languages, MIT Press, 1994, ISBN 0-262-19349-3
  6. ^ http://dingo.sbs.arizona.edu/~hammond/ling178-sp06/mathCh6.pdf
Personal tools
Namespaces

Variants
Actions
Navigation
Interaction
Toolbox
Print/export